How To Fix CRM_LEASING_COPY089 - Contract is already active


SAP Error Message - Details

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: CRM_LEASING_COPY - Messaages to/from Creation of Follow-Up Document

  • Message number: 089

  • Message text: Contract is already active

  • What is the cause and solution for SAP error message CRM_LEASING_COPY089 - Contract is already active ?

    The SAP error message "CRM_LEASING_COPY089: Contract is already active" typically occurs in the context of contract management within the SAP CRM (Customer Relationship Management) system, particularly when dealing with leasing contracts. This error indicates that the contract you are trying to copy or modify is already in an active state, which prevents further changes or copying.

    Cause:

    1. Active Contract: The primary cause of this error is that the contract you are attempting to copy or modify is already active in the system. Active contracts cannot be duplicated or altered in a way that would conflict with their current status.
    2. Incorrect Process Flow: The process you are following may not align with the expected workflow for handling active contracts.
    3. System Configuration: There may be specific configurations or settings in the SAP system that restrict actions on active contracts.

    Solution:

    1. Check Contract Status: Verify the status of the contract in question. If it is indeed active, you will need to either complete the necessary actions on the active contract or consider creating a new contract instead of copying the existing one.
    2. Review Process: Ensure that you are following the correct process for handling contracts in your organization. If you need to make changes, consider whether you can do so directly on the active contract.
    3. Consult Documentation: Refer to SAP documentation or your organization's internal guidelines for managing contracts to understand the proper procedures.
    4. Use Change Functionality: If you need to make modifications, use the change functionality for the active contract rather than attempting to copy it.
    5. Contact Support: If you believe this error is occurring inappropriately or if you need further assistance, consider reaching out to your SAP support team or consulting with an SAP expert.
